Job Description:
Basic Function:
The licensed Facility Operator operates and maintains the Central Steam and Co-generation Facility, on a shift basis, under the direction of the Chief Engineer per Massachusetts General Law Chapter 146 section 49. The Facilities operator will monitor steam, hot water, cooling, and Co-generation electrical systems including all other auxiliary components within the Facility.
Major Responsibilities:
- Maintains a shift in the operation and maintenance of the Facility. This will include monitoring correct water level and proper steam and or water pressure, maintaining records, logs, charts and reports related to facility operation.
- Place boilers on or off line according to demands.
- Perform routine maintenance in the Boiler Room and Co-generation Facilities.
- Perform Boiler water treatment tests on shift. Manually add chemicals and water to chemical tanks.
- Must be available periodically for emergency shift coverage due to illness of other Facility Operators.
- Maintain adequate fuel levels', make necessary additions to fuel levels by adding when warranted.
- Perform hourly readings on boilers, natural gas reciprocating engine and generator equipment.
- Follow and adhere to all maintenance schedules related to equipment within the facility.
- Clean, paint, and lubricate all Central Utility Plant auxiliary equipment as needed.
- Sweep, mop and paint floors within the Central Utility Plant as directed by the Chief Engineer.
